Manchester, UK-based payments router AccessPay has secured £2 million in debt financing from Clydesdale and Yorkshire Bank amid plans for a recruitment drive and expansion into US markets. A specialist in cloud-based payments technology, with hundreds of UK-based customers and 35 employees, AccessPay enables payment routing through all of the major UK and international networks including Bacs, Swift, Faster Payments, Sepa and Direct Debit. With a focus on organic growth, the orgnisation has its sights on increasing its business-reach to more than 10,000 organisations, who will join with other current high-profile clients such as Clifford Thames and European research organisation Cern. Anish Kapoor, CEO of Accesspay says the funding will enable the business to recruit up to 60 new members of staff, including developers, sales, operations and marketing, before the end of 2017 and provides the platform for expansion into the US market later this year. Lodha Group plans to resume sales at Trump Tower Mumbai after a post-election hiatus, providing a test for India’s languishing luxury home market, and the U.S. president’s brand. Lodha, one of India’s largest property developers, will resume marketing apartments in the 75-story development in the next few months, said Abhishek Lodha, managing director of the privately held firm.
